Basket Table: Storage on Wheels

This mobile end table organizes clutter with the flip of a lid, and can be whisked off to wherever it's needed. Start by painting the basket and lid.

Materials
Sturdy, lidded basket
Four 1-by-2s
Latex satin-finish paint
Scrap lumber
Six 1 1/4-inch wood screws
Power screwdriver
Four casters and screws

Basket Table How-To
1. Position two 1-by-2s, cut 2 inches shorter than basket's length, inside basket 1 inch from each side. Align with second pair -- cut the same length, mitered at a 45-degree angle, and painted -- placed on the underside, with scrap lumber beneath. From inside basket, join three layers with wood screws

2. Screw casters to supports on bottom of basket. If you plan to put heavy books or plants on top of the lid, it's a good idea to insert a strong plastic or wooden lidded box inside the basket, flush with the rim, for additional support.
